Will a young ABBOTT'S OKEETEE CORN SNAKE keep the same vibrant colors when it gets to full size/full maturity? I have seen pictures online and thought it would be the perfect variety that I would like. If the underside is black and white, will that remain or will it fade? I want a snake that is beautiful young, but does not lose the color when it matures. Will it get 4 feet long as is typical?
